Is Aemetis, Inc. (AMTX) a Good Investment?

Claude

AEMETIS is technically insolvent with -$321.1M stockholders' equity and faces an acute liquidity crisis (0.09x current ratio) with only $4.8M cash against $62M long-term debt. The company is burning cash (-$10.6M operating CF, -$17.1M free CF) while revenue collapsed 26% YoY and net margins deteriorated to -39.8%, indicating fundamental operational distress without near-term recovery visibility.

ChatGPT

Aemetis shows severely stressed fundamentals: revenue is shrinking sharply, gross margin has turned negative, and operating and net losses remain very large relative to sales. Financial health is especially weak, with negative equity, extremely poor liquidity, weak interest coverage, and negative free cash flow, which together suggest a high dependence on external financing despite a modest improvement in net loss and positive operating cash flow.
